The Program & Volunteer Coordinator is responsible for assisting with the development and delivery of high-quality, cost-efficient programs and events for USO Centers, supporting tasks related to administration, direction, and recognition of volunteers.
* Develop, plan, and execute outreach programs and events in coordination with USO leadership and external agencies. Solicit and develop resources to support USO events. Acquire and purchase program supplies.
* Serve as a knowledgeable resource about programs, events, and services at the USO Center, ensuring they are scheduled and executed within budget.
* Coordinate volunteer operations, including recruiting, training, scheduling, and managing logistics for volunteers and events.
* Assist with communication efforts, including writing announcements, flyers, and social media content. Collect stories and photos for publicity.
* Perform administrative duties as needed and other duties as assigned.
Job Specifications
* High School Diploma or equivalent; Bachelor’s Degree preferred.
* 0-2 years experience in administrative, event management, or marketing support; nonprofit or military experience preferred.
* Knowledge of safe food handling and promotional material design.
* Strong interpersonal, customer service, and communication skills.
* Punctual, organized, adaptable, and team-oriented.
* Basic math and cash handling skills.
* Ability to obtain necessary credentials for USO access.
* Supportive of the USO’s mission.
